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Villarín, is also a hot month, with an average temperature ranging between min 24.8°C (76.6°F) and max 30.2°C (86.4°F).

Temperature

As Villarín welcomes August, the average high-temperature is noted at a still tropical 30.2°C (86.4°F), closely aligning with the preceding month. In the month of August, the average low-temperature usually rests at a warm 24.8°C (76.6°F).

Heat index

August's average heat index is appraised at a fiery hot 37°C (98.6°F). Exercise heightened safety,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are probable. Persistent activity may provoke heatstroke.
Heat index evaluations are typically in the context of light winds and shaded environments. The heat index values could be amplified by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ees in dire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'feels like', reflects the feeling of heat when considering both air temperature and humidity. The influence of weather is personal, differing among individuals based on variations in body mass, stature, and the degree of physical exertion. Direct sun rays have a notable impact on perceived temperature, which can raise the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ly meaningful for babies and toddlers. Children typically face more danger than adults as their sweat production is usually lower. Additionally, the bigger skin surface compared to their small size and the increased heat due to their activeness exacerbate the risk.
Perspiration, followed by sweat evaporation, is the human body's chief method to maintain a balanced temperature. High relative humidity reduces the evaporation rate, resulting in a lower heat removal rate from the body, causing the perception of being overheated. Overheating dangers loom when the body's heat release mechanisms are overshadowed by excessive gain.

Humidity

In August, the average relative humidity is 77%.

Rainfall

In Villarín, Mexico, during August, the rain falls for 22.2 days and regularly aggregates up to 140mm (5.51") of precipitation. In Villarín, during the entire year, the rain falls for 162.3 days and collects up to 755mm (29.72")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Villarín, the average length of the day in August is 12h and 46min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:01 am and sunset at 7:00 pm.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 6:09 am and sunset at 6:40 pm CST.

Sunshine

In Villarín, the average sunshine in August is 9.3h.

UV index

March through September,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: The maximum UV index of 7 during August leads to these instructions:
Implement precautions and maintain sun safety methods. Avoidance of sunburn is demanded. Avoid direct Sun exposure from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., a period when UV radiation is most intense, and remember that not all shade structures provide full protection. Stay sun-safe with clothing that is both closely woven and worn loosely.
